14 Introduction to ED medium voltage networks 3-phase system, 20 kv, 10 kv open loops, radially operated disconnectors in open points between feeders, partly remotely controlled backup routes neutral isolated or system earthed via arc-suppression coil (centralized or distributed) protection by relays and circuit-breakers typical transmission capacity some megawatts and km (in Lapland areas even 100 km) 14

15 Introduction to ED medium voltage networks Overhead lines ACSR conductors mm 2 price k /km Covered over head lines (PAS-lines) thin isolation not full touch safety more narrow line route, double and triple lines lower fault rate % more expensive than overhead line High voltage overhead cable SAXKA used when special environment requirements Underground cables full isolation, plastics cross-sections mm 2 price k /km based on digging environment 15

16 Introduction to ED distribution substations Disconnector between 20 kv line and transformer Substation + transformer pole mounted substations in overhead networks bad mounted or building substations in cable networks Low voltage substation simple fuse-box in pole mounted substations real swicthboard in pad-mounted substations Body of transformer is grounded (connected to earth, protection against touch voltages) 16

17 Introduction to ED low voltage networks 3-phase system, neutral (neutral conductor) earthed Radial network, rarely backup connections AMKA-conductors (aerial bundled cable) in rural areas mm 2, k /km Plastic underground cables in urban networks ploughing when possible mm 2, k /km swicthing boxes Protection by fuses; overload, short circuit, touch voltages Protective and neutral groundings are connected to each other 17

23 Introduction to ED design of lines Main constraints voltage drop long 20 kv and 0.4 kv over head lines losses main 20 kv overhead lines thermal capacity main 20 kv and 0,4 kv lines in cable networks short-circuit current conductors of 20 kv branch lines near to feeding point (110/20 kv primary substation) quick operation of fuses (short circuit current vs. fuse size) long distance 0.4 kv lines having low loads reliability medium voltage networks and primary substations economy always important 23
